Department LAB is equipped with state-of-the-art computer laboratories comprising Intel Core i3 desktops (3.10 GHz, 8 GB RAM, 500 GB HDD), ensuring a robust platform for academic and practical learning. These systems are supported by a comprehensive range of peripherals and auxiliary hardware to facilitate hands-on training and project development.
Students have access to high-speed internet through a dedicated 16 Mbps broadband connection. Furthermore, the campus is integrated via a 100 Mbps switched Ethernet local area network (LAN), creating a dynamic intranet environment for efficient file sharing, collaborative learning, and digital resource access.
